Monolaurin is known for its antimicrobial properties, which may help in fighting against various pathogens such as bacteria, viruses, and fungi.
Research suggests that monolaurin may help support the immune system by enhancing the body's defense mechanisms against infections.
Monolaurin has been studied for its potential antiviral effects, particularly against lipid-coated viruses such as herpes simplex virus and influenza virus.
Some studies indicate that monolaurin may possess anti-inflammatory properties, which could help in reducing inflammation in the body.
Monolaurin has been suggested to have a positive impact on cholesterol levels by helping to regulate lipid metabolism.
These health benefits of monolaurin 600 mg highlight its potential role in supporting overall health and well-being.

Monolaurin is a supplement known for its potential immune-boosting properties. If you are looking for an alternative to Monolaurin 600 mg, one option to consider is coconut oil. Coconut oil contains lauric acid, which is the precursor to monolaurin in the body.
According to the National Institutes of Health, lauric acid has antimicrobial and antiviral properties that may help support the immune system. Coconut oil can be consumed as a dietary supplement or used in cooking and baking.
It is important to note that while coconut oil may offer similar benefits to Monolaurin, the concentration of lauric acid may vary depending on the brand and processing methods. It is recommended to choose a high-quality, organic coconut oil for the best results.
